One dead, one seriously injured in Greensboro motorcycle crash

1 dead, one injured in Greensboro motorcycle crash Gustavo Toldeo-Rodriguez lost control of his motorcycle and was ejected from the bike on Old Battleground Ave., police said Author: Chris Venzon (WFMY News2) Published: 5:23 PM EDT April 8, 2021 Updated: 5:43 PM EDT April 8, 2021 GREENSBORO, N.C. A man is dead and a woman is severely injured from a motorcycle crash Thursday, Greensboro police said. The wreck happened just after 11 a.m. on Old Battleground Ave. Gustavo Toledo-Rodriguez, 29, was riding his motorcycle with Grecia Urdaneta-Castillo, 30, when he lost control, police said. Toledo-Rodriguez spilled the bike and was ejected. He died on the scene, GPD said. Urdaneta-Castillo was thrown from the motorcycle as well and is seriously injured, officers said.

By Mark Starling Fire Breaks Out At Canton Manufacturing Plant (Canton, NC) A fire at a manufacturing plant is being investigated in Canton. Flames erupted inside Evergreen Packaging on Monday morning, but never caused any visible damage on the outside. No injuries were reported. It s been half-a-year since two contract workers were killed inside Evergreen Packaging after a heat gun fell into a bucket of resin. Hiker Rescued After Fall In Pisgah National Forest (Transylvania County, NC) A hiker is somehow escaping with only minor injuries after a big fall in the Pisgah National Forest. Transylvania County rescue crews rushed out last weekend to Slate Rock, where someone reportedly fell and tumbled around one-thousand-feet. It took six-hours to complete the rescue, as emergency workers helped the victim walk away from the site.

Guilford Courthouse National Park temporarily closed due to winter storm

County officials said the park is closed due to damage from Saturday’s ice storm. Author: Terrence Jefferies (WFMY News 2) Published: 4:26 PM EST February 14, 2021 Updated: 4:26 PM EST February 14, 2021 GUILFORD COUNTY, N.C. Guilford County officials announced Sunday the Guilford Courthouse National Military Park is temporarily closed due significant ice damage over the weekend. Officials said the park is closed due to damage from Saturday’s ice storm. According to park officials, the ice caused damage to trees within the park impacting powerlines, trails, the loop tour road, and the parking lot at the intersection of Old Battleground and New Garden Road.
